Twin loft beds are designed with the sleeping area 6 feet above ground. This design allows for
the space to be used under the bed for other purposes such as storage and work. There are many styles available on
the market most appealing to young children due to their bright colors.
To maximize space usage, invest in beds that are single that is beds without a sleeping area
below the loft bed. Carry the kids along so that they can choose the bed they want. It is also good if you could
get both to choose the same color this is not a requirement, however kids can be picky at times so taking them
along will let them feel from the start that this project is benefitting their needs.
You can also purchase a desk this can be placed under the bed and used for an individual work
space, this will give each child their own working or computer area. If you're low on closet space you can also use
the additional area to place a closet bar so as to hang clothes. There is enough space to accommodate a desk
and a clothes rack.
You can be as creative with the space as possible if you're low on household space you can use
one the twin loft bed to house both desks and the other for the storage of items. The mattress usually comes
as a twin size mattress so finding fitted sheets will be easy. You can visit any discount store and pick up a set
of twin fitted sheets for under ten dollars.
